aboutsummaryrefslogtreecommitdiffstats
path: root/package/kernel/modules/fs.mk
diff options
context:
space:
mode:
authorHauke Mehrtens <hauke@openwrt.org>2009-05-11 20:46:01 +0000
committerHauke Mehrtens <hauke@openwrt.org>2009-05-11 20:46:01 +0000
commitb7d2130b7618a0a84c7eff33d35b5c8ff38b57c3 (patch)
tree38f007a75feaa701e9266833396dc3a33f95e79d /package/kernel/modules/fs.mk
parent315ebbce32c83084a2ce107d48c18063cbfbd308 (diff)
downloadupstream-b7d2130b7618a0a84c7eff33d35b5c8ff38b57c3.tar.gz
upstream-b7d2130b7618a0a84c7eff33d35b5c8ff38b57c3.tar.bz2
upstream-b7d2130b7618a0a84c7eff33d35b5c8ff38b57c3.zip
[kernel] The vfat directory have chanced with all newer kernel.
git-svn-id: svn://svn.openwrt.org/openwrt/trunk@15782 3c298f89-4303-0410-b956-a3cf2f4a3e73
Diffstat (limited to 'package/kernel/modules/fs.mk')
-rw-r--r--package/kernel/modules/fs.mk6
1 files changed, 5 insertions, 1 deletions
diff --git a/package/kernel/modules/fs.mk b/package/kernel/modules/fs.mk
index 0d35773170..483e6369ce 100644
--- a/package/kernel/modules/fs.mk
+++ b/package/kernel/modules/fs.mk
@@ -315,6 +315,10 @@ endef
$(eval $(call KernelPackage,fs-reiserfs))
+ifeq ($(strip $(call CompareKernelPatchVer,$(KERNEL_PATCHVER),ge,2.6.28)),1)
+ VFAT_DIR:=fat
+endif
+VFAT_DIR?=vfat
define KernelPackage/fs-vfat
SUBMENU:=$(FS_MENU)
@@ -324,7 +328,7 @@ define KernelPackage/fs-vfat
CONFIG_VFAT_FS
FILES:= \
$(LINUX_DIR)/fs/fat/fat.$(LINUX_KMOD_SUFFIX) \
- $(LINUX_DIR)/fs/$(if $(CONFIG_LINUX_2_6_28),fat,vfat)/vfat.$(LINUX_KMOD_SUFFIX)
+ $(LINUX_DIR)/fs/$(VFAT_DIR)/vfat.$(LINUX_KMOD_SUFFIX)
AUTOLOAD:=$(call AutoLoad,30,fat vfat)
$(call KernelPackage/nls/Depends)
endef